    Collective Efficacy: A Resilience Factor to Adverse Childhood Experiences and Externalizing Behaviors

    No full text
    Adverse childhood experience (ACE) exposures, which include one or more encounters of psychological, physical, and sexual abuse or household dysfunction, touch the lives of a third of all children under the age of 17 in the United States. Less is understood as to how externalizing behaviors in adolescence are influenced by specific aspects of ACEs such as household dysfunction. Further, it is unclear whether the construct of collective efficacy can buffer the negative relationships between household dysfunction and adolescent externalizing behaviors. Prior studies have identified individual, family, and community factors that contribute to family resilience, which is defined as successfully utilizing protective factors to emerge more resilient from challenging situations. However, community resilience factors that are protective of the negative correlates of household dysfunction in the context of adverse childhood experiences (ACEs), such as collective efficacy for externalizing behaviors, have seldom been researched. This study examined the relationships among household dysfunction, collective efficacy, and externalizing behaviors in U.S. adolescents. Data for this study were obtained through the largest ongoing longitudinal research initiative on adolescent development: the Adolescent Brain Cognitive Development (ABCD) study. Participants included N = 11,868 youth and their parents/guardians. This study analyzed the following constructs assessed using a combination of adolescent and parent/guardian reports: household dysfunction (measured at adolescent age 9-10; Wave 1), adolescent externalizing behaviors (measured at age 11-12 and 12-13; Waves 3 and 4), and collective efficacy (measured at age 11-12). The analytic plan for this study includes conducting multiple regression analysis among study variables, using household dysfunction and collective efficacy to predict externalizing behaviors while controlling for demographic covariates, and moderation analysis through regression to evaluate the buffering role of collective efficacy for the association between household dysfunction and externalizing behaviors. The results showed that household dysfunction measured at Wave 1 was significant in positively predicting externalizing behaviors at Wave 3, Wave 4, and at Wave 4 with prior levels at Wave 3 controlled. Collective efficacy measured at Wave 3 was significantly and negatively associated with externalizing behaviors both concurrently and longitudinally a year later, although the association became nonsignificant after controlling for prior levels of externalizing behaviors. Further, collective efficacy attenuated the relationships of household dysfunction at Wave 1 to externalizing behaviors at Wave 3, Wave 4, and at Wave 4 with prior levels at Wave 3 controlled. These study findings offer insights into how both household- and neighborhood-level factors contribute to adolescent behavioral health and suggest that collective efficacy can serve as a promotive and protective resilience factor that ignites positive changes in the trajectory of externalizing behaviors.Family and Consumer Science

    Effectiveness of Diamond Grinding in Enhancing Rigid Pavement Performance: A Review of Key Metrics

    No full text
    Diamond grinding is a key concrete pavement restoration technique for concrete pavements. Traffic degrades the serviceability of the concrete pavements, resulting in unsatisfactory skid levels and noise concerns. Diamond grinding is known to enhance longevity and performance by improving smoothness and friction. By removing flaws with a cutting head equipped with diamond blades, the procedure produces a “corduroy” texture that enhances braking and stability. Diamond grinding typically results in a 20–80% reduction in the International Roughness Index, significantly enhancing pavement smoothness. It also improves macrotexture and creates longitudinal drainage channels, which collectively increase skid resistance and lower the chance of hydroplaning. The paper aims to highlight the need for diamond grinding for concrete pavements, which, despite their longevity, have decreased serviceability from traffic. The review further explores emerging innovations and identifies the gaps in long-term performance tracking and life-cycle environmental assessment. This paper reviews the effectiveness of diamond grinding as a pavement rehabilitation technique, with emphasis on ride quality, surface friction, noise reduction, and durability. Field applications and evaluation metrics are discussed to assess their contribution to pavement performance. This review aims to support researchers, pavement engineers, and agencies by providing a comprehensive understanding of diamond grinding’s applications, performance metrics, and potential for sustainable pavement management.Materials Science, Engineering, and CommercializationEngineering Technolog

    The Structure of Moral Agency and the Ethical Crisis of Gen-AI (Misuse) in Higher Education: Comparative Foundations in Fichte and Beauvoir

    No full text
    This thesis develops a robust moral framework, integrating the moral thought of Johann Gottlieb Fichte and Simone de Beauvoir, in order to critically analyze the contemporary ethical crisis precipitated by the growing predominance of generative artificial intelligence (GenAI) in higher education. By comparatively examining Fichte’s ethical idealism and Beauvoir’s existential phenomenology, and highlighting the crucial themes of self-determination, dynamic self-formation amid ambiguity, and reciprocal recognition, this thesis goes on to identify a unifying moral concept that will serve as this inquiry’s normative standard. I argue that the instrumentalist orientation deeply embedded in contemporary American culture, especially within education, fundamentally undermines the ethical insights derived from this analysis, enabling and intensifying acts of academic dishonesty such as AI-generated plagiarism, inauthentic scholarship, and intellectual disengagement. This thesis elucidates why such practices are not merely violations of academic integrity, but signal profound ethical failures that erode authentic moral and epistemic agency within the communal spheres of academia. The argumentative structure of this thesis reflects this trajectory: establishing the conceptual foundations and the Fichtean-Beauvoirian framework (Chapter 1); diagnosing the cultural and institutional pathologies, particularly instrumentalism, and their implications for higher education (Chapter 2); proceeding to practical application (Chapter 3); and recommendations for educational communities, culminating in a conclusion that clarifies the broader significance and future directions of these findings (Chapter 4). Ultimately, this thesis aims to reaffirm the centrality of authenticity as a fundamental ideal for the moral and intellectual future of higher education.Philosoph

    Urban Emission Patterns and Air Quality Disparities: A Spatial-Statistical Analysis of GHG Emissions across U.S. Cities

    No full text
    Air pollution remains a critical environmental health concern, with fine particulate matter (PM₂.₅) representing the most pervasive and hazardous pollutant. Despite overall improvement in national air quality, disparities persist across U.S. regions, driven by population dynamics, industrial structure, and environmental geography. This study investigates regional variations in PM₂.₅ concentrations across thirty major U.S. metropolitan areas, employing a spatial–statistical approach anchored on the World Health Organization’s 5 µg/m³ guideline. Using cross-sectional data for 2020, the research integrates descriptive spatial analysis, ANOVA, multiple regression, and logistic modeling to evaluate the relationships between PM₂.₅, greenhouse gas emissions, population density, and regional structural attributes. Findings reveal pronounced regional disparities: Western and Southern cities recorded significantly higher PM₂.₅ levels and greater WHO exceedance rates than Northeastern counterparts. Regression outcomes demonstrate that population density alone does not explain these variations; rather, regional characteristics such as wildfire exposure, transport dependence, and industrial concentration exert a stronger predictive influence. The study contributes to urban environmental governance by reframing U.S. air-quality policy within a spatial-justice and public-health context. It recommends differentiated, region-specific interventions that recognize the socio-environmental heterogeneity of urban America while advancing global alignment with WHO health protection standards.Sociolog

    A Multi-Resolution Attention U-Net for Pavement Distress Segmentation in 3D Images: Architecture and Data-Driven Insights

    No full text
    High-resolution 3D pavement images have become a valuable data source for automated surface distress detection and assessment. However, accurately identifying and segmenting cracks from pavement images remains challenging, due to factors such as low contrast and hair-like thinness. This study investigates key factors affecting segmentation performance and proposes a novel deep learning architecture designed to enhance segmentation robustness under these challenging conditions. The proposed model integrates a multi-resolution feature extraction stream with gated attention mechanisms to improve spatial awareness and selectively fuse information across feature levels. Our extensive experiments on a 3D pavement dataset demonstrated that the proposed method outperformed several state-of-the-art architectures, including FCN, U-Net, DeepLab, DeepCrack, and CrackFormer. Compared with U-Net, it improved F1 from 0.733 to 0.780. The gains were most pronounced on thin cracks, with F1 from 0.531 to 0.626. Our paired t-tests across folds showed the method is statistically better than U-Net and DeepCrack on Recall, IoU, Dice, and F1. These findings highlight the effectiveness of the attention-guided, multi-scale feature fusion method for robust crack segmentation using 3D pavement data.Engineerin

    Targeting Cytokine Dysregulation in Psoriasis: The Role of Dietary Interventions in Modulating the Immune Response

    No full text
    Psoriasis is a chronic immune-mediated skin disease characterized by cytokine dysregulation. Pro-inflammatory mediators, including tumor necrosis factor-alpha (TNF-α), interleukin (IL)-17, and IL-23, play pivotal roles in the pathogenesis of psoriasis. Emerging evidence suggests that dietary interventions can modulate cytokine activity, providing a complementary approach to standard therapies. This narrative review examines the impact of various dietary strategies, including a Mediterranean diet, ketogenic diet, gluten-free diet, and fasting-mimicking diet, on cytokine profiles and clinical outcomes in psoriasis. Research insights reveal that dietary components such as omega-3 fatty acids, polyphenols, and short-chain fatty acids influence immune signaling pathways. These pathways include nuclear factor-kappa B (NF-κB) and Signal Transducer and Activator of Transcription 3 (STAT3). Additionally, these dietary components promote anti-inflammatory effects mediated by gut microbiota. Clinical studies demonstrate significant reductions in psoriasis severity, improved quality of life, and modulation of key cytokines associated with disease activity. Despite these advancements, significant challenges persist in effectively integrating these findings into clinical practice. These challenges include variability in patient responses, adherence issues, and the need for robust biomarkers to monitor efficacy. Future directions emphasize the potential of personalized nutrition and precision medicine approaches to optimize dietary interventions tailored to individual cytokine profiles and genetic predispositions. Integrating these strategies into psoriasis care could transform treatment paradigms by simultaneously addressing both systemic inflammation and comorbid conditions.Division of Researc

    Towards Characterizing Machine Learning Contracts using Large Language Models

    No full text
    Machine Learning (ML) contracts formally describe expected behavior and constraints before calling ML APIs. In practice, developers rely on incomplete docs or informal Q&A, leading to subtle misuses and contract violations. We address this by using Retrieval-Augmented Generation (RAG) with large language models (LLMs) to automatically characterize multi-label ML contracts from Stack Overflow posts: semantically similar, labeled examples are retrieved and paired with a concise taxonomy primer to produce structured labels across multiple levels. Beyond labeling, we additionally synthesize executable Python PyContracts with brief natural-language summaries and actionable fixes, and validate them via a lightweight Judge LLM plus a human-in-the-loop review that ensures contracts reproduce the reported fault and then pass after minimal repair. Our approach achieves up to 0.86 F1-score on challenging labels, processes posts in 3–5s at low cost, produces insights rated 75–80% relevant but only 25–30% actionable, and both GPT and Claude reach 100% executable PyContracts after guided repair. On a human-annotated corpus, retrieval-guided prompting improves label quality, and the contract stage attains high compile/run rates while guiding targeted fixes. This provides a practical bridge from informal Q&A to enforceable, verified ML contracts. We demonstrate practical utility through a VS Code extension that integrates our RAG-based contract detection and PyContract generation directly into the development workflow, enabling real-time violation detection, automated contract synthesis with iterative feedback loops, and interactive violation analysis with comprehensive label explanations.Computer Scienc

    Political Polarization and Positive Peace: Lessons from American Philosophy

    No full text
    This presentation to the Rotary Club of Marblehead Harbor (MA) examines Political Polarization and Positive Peace and connects them to the ideas and actions of American Philosophers with a focus on John Dewey and Jane Addams. Political polarization taken to an extreme can lead to violence. Using philosophical concepts like the “community of inquiry” and “peaceweaving’ this paper shows how service organizations like Rotary and churches, can mitigate the most serious consequences of political polarization. They do this by building friendly relationships as the work across ideological differences to resolve practical community problems. Founding Rotarian principles such as "Service Above Self” are integrated into the presentation.Political Scienc

    Microplastic-Mediated Delivery of Di-butyl Phthalate Alters C. elegans Lifespan and Reproductive Fidelity

    No full text
    Microplastics harbor chemical additives and absorb pollutants from the environment. Microplastics pose a human health threat and have been found in nearly all human tissues. The toxicological pathways and physiological effects of microplastic-mediated chemical exposure following ingestion remain unknown. Here we use Caenorhabditis elegans to investigate the effects of di-butyl phthalate and polystyrene microplastic mixtures on fertility and lifespan. Our studies demonstrate that 1 µm microplastics at 1 mg/L exposure levels result in decreased brood size, whereas 1000 times fewer microplastics (1 µg/L) did not affect the number of eggs laid. While there was no change in brood size at 1 µg/L microplastic exposure levels, there was an increase in embryonic lethality. Microplastics-mediated delivery of di-butyl phthalate to C. elegans significantly reduced brood size and increased embryonic lethality compared to exposure to microplastics alone. This reproductive toxicity is potentially due to a stress response via DAF-16, as observed with microplastics and di-butyl phthalate co-exposure. Furthermore, chronic exposure (from hatching onward) to microplastics shortened the lifespan of C. elegans, which was further reduced with di-butyl phthalate co-exposure. The exacerbated defects observed with co-exposure to phthalate-containing microplastics underscore the risks associated with microplastics releasing the additives and/or chemicals that they have absorbed from the environment.Chemistry and Biochemistr

    Postpartum Depression and Racism: A Systematic Review [poster]

    No full text
    Introduction: Postpartum depression (PPD) affects up to 20% of women in the United States, with significantly higher rates among those in racial and ethnic minorities. Emerging evidence suggests that racial discrimination may contribute to this disparity by increasing psychosocial stress during the perinatal period. This systematic review examines the association between perceived racial discrimination and the incidence and severity of postpartum depressive symptoms. Methods: A systematic search was conducted across CINAHL, PubMed, MedlinePlus, Science Direct, Oxford Academic, Trip database, and Clinicaltrials.gov for peer-reviewed United States. studies published between 2020 and 2025. Inclusion criteria required postpartum participants, assessment of racial discrimination, and depression symptom severity as outcomes. Studies were appraised using the Rapid Critical Appraisal (RCA) tool, and synthesis followed PRISMA and Whittemore & Knafl’s integrative review framework. Results: Seven studies met inclusion criteria; the majority utilized a cross-sectional or secondary data analysis with validated measures such as the Edinburgh Postnatal Depression Scale and Everyday Discrimination Scale. Across the studies, racial discrimination was significantly associated with increased postpartum depressive symptoms. Additional themes identified included racism in healthcare as a barrier to diagnosis and care, and social support and resilience as protective factors mitigating depressive outcomes. Discussion: Findings demonstrated that racial discrimination functions as a social determinant of postpartum mental health. Integrating culturally sensitive screening, bias reduction training, and community-based support interventions is essential to reduce disparities. Future longitudinal research should explore causal pathways and resilience mechanisms.Nursin
